Gefrorene kirschen Nutrients FAQs
Nutrients
- Vitamin A:Gefrorene kirschen has 1348.5 IU of Vitamin A.
- Vitamin B-6:Gefrorene kirschen has 0.1039 mg of Vitamin B-6.
- Vitamin C:Gefrorene kirschen has 2.635 mg of Vitamin C.
- Gefrorene kirschen has 20.15mg of Calcium.
- Gefrorene kirschen has 1.55mg of Sodium, Na.
- Gefrorene kirschen has 192.2mg of Potassium, K.
- Gefrorene kirschen has 0.8215mg of Iron.
What is the calorie content of Gefrorene kirschen?
A typical serving 155 gramm (155 grams) of Gefrorene kirschen contains approximately 71 calories.

How much fat content does a Gefrorene kirschen have?
The amount of fat in Gefrorene kirschen depends on the ingredients and preparation method. On average, one serving 155 gramm (155 grams) of Gefrorene kirschen contains approximately 0.68 grams of fat.

How much protein does a Gefrorene kirschen have?
The protein content in Gefrorene kirschen depends on the ingredients exists in it. On average, 155 gramm (155 grams) of Gefrorene kirschen contains approximately 1.43 grams of protein.

How much sugar does a Gefrorene kirschen have?
On average, 155 gramm (155 grams) contains about 13.98 grams of sugar.

How Much carbohydrates (carbs) is in Gefrorene kirschen?
The amount of carbohydrates (carbs) in Gefrorene kirschen depends on its serving size and preparation. On average, 155 gramm (155 grams) contains about 17.08 grams of carbohydrates.

How Much Fiber is in Gefrorene kirschen?
Gefrorene kirschen contains approximately 2.48 grams of fiber in 155 gramm (155 grams).
